DART ridership throughout Dallas sets record for second straight month

In June 2008, DART saw 10.3 million total trips on its buses, trains and HOV lanes, making it the biggest month ever for the transit agency, topping May's record of 10.28 million trips.
Both DART Rail (69,861 trips) and the Trinity Railway Express (11,105 trips) posted their highest-ever average weekday ridership totals. DART Rail was up 14.2% over June 2007 and the TRE was up 19.8% over the same period.
Commuters continue sharing the ride in the HOV lanes. There were more than 4.5 million trips made in the expanded HOV-lane system.
That number, when combined with ridership on other DART services, yielded a 20.1% increase in ridership over June 2007.
DART Rail:
Average weekday = 69,861 (14.2% gain over June 2007)
Monthly total = 1,687,827 (up 13.6% over June 2007)
Trinity Railway Express:
Average weekday = 11,105 (19.8% gain over June 2007)
Monthly total = 251,522 (up 17.0% over June 2007)
DART Bus:
Average weekday = 157,794 (up 6.8% over June 2007)
Monthly total = 3,832,455 (up 6.2% over June 2007)
HOV Lanes:
Average weekday = 165,170 (up 37.3% over June 2007)
Monthly total = 4,529,000 (up 38.7% over June 2007)
Source: DART
